Board Director-at-Large

  • Learn a bit about Roberts Rules of Order — not that you need to be a parliamentarian, but it helps to understand the flow of the meeting.
  • If documents are sent out before meetings, read them. Your fellow board members will appreciate it.
  • Don’t worry if you feel you don’t have a great deal to contribute on one particular issue; other issues will draw you in. At the same time, if you have an opinion or contribution, make it.
    • But do remember that you (most likely)have excellent committee experience and may have a lot of knowledge about that area – share it!
  • Remember that LITA Board is looking broadly, strategically, and towards the future.
  • Have fun and be social with your fellow LITAns as much as you can.

Filtering your Connect email

You can have Connect discussions emailed to you, and then filter them to the same place as your Board email. This will make it much easier to read documents before meetings, per above.

To activate Connect email notifications, if needed:

  • Go to the “[Yourname]’s Account” dropdown in the upper right corner of Connect
  • Make sure you have checked the `LITA Board of Directors` line

Your favorite email program can then filter on subject lines that contain ‘[ALA Connect] LITA Board of Directors’.
